High-sensitivity Tonearm To enable the tonearm to precisely track the record's rotation, Technics has traditionally used the static balance, S-type universal tonearm with a lightweight, high damping magnesium tonearm pipe. The later MKII model tonearm which is the one found on the SL1200MKII and SL1700MKII in the review above, is a more medium mass at 12-13g and shares a closer family resemblence, at least visually with the Technics EPA-100/250/500 high end tonearms.
